## 2.9.0 — Changed defaults (fan-out backpressure)

The Hollowpine notifier now applies backpressure by default. Fan-out batches shrink automatically when downstream latency rises; previously we dropped messages silently. If you're onboarding: don't re-enable the old drop behavior, it masked outages twice last quarter. Overrides go in the per-tenant file, not the global one. The new shipped defaults are listed here:

deployment values, yafop-tahof:
HOLIX_HOST=holix.zemvarsys.internal
HOLIX_PORT=3306

## Partner SFTP Drop — Marlowe Freight

Files land nightly between 02:00–03:30 UTC in the inbound drop. Watcher job `marlowe-ingest` picks them up; if nothing arrives by 04:00, the Quillhook alert fires. Do NOT re-request files from Marlowe before checking the quarantine folder — malformed headers get parked there silently. Retries are safe; ingest is idempotent on file checksum. Rotation of the drop credentials is quarterly, owned by platform. Full escalation steps and contacts are on the runbook page.

dashboard of taduf-tahof = https://confluence.tolvaqlabs.internal/browse/browse/display/f01240ca

Runbook: Password reset revamp (Project Amberline). The new flow replaces emailed tokens with single-use codes hashed at rest and expiring in 10 minutes. Reviewers should verify: constant-time comparison on code check, rate limiting of 5 attempts per account per hour, and that old reset tokens are invalidated on rollout. The legacy endpoint stays behind a feature flag for two releases, then is removed. The design doc, threat notes, and test matrix are kept on the internal page that follows.

wiki page, tahaf-tajog: https://jira.ordindyn.corp/pipeline